If you shut down your natural testosterone production for long enough, you lose your fertility, but there are some drugs out there that stop you from shutting down on TRT, such as HCG, but alot of people who get prescribed trt arnt given hcg, even though they should be. So they go infertile.

To answer your question ( I think) a proper first cycle includes an AAS like test enanthate with an AI while on cycle to control elevated estrogen and the associated sides followed by a well thought out Post cycle therapy or pct. this is designed to artificially raise your T and control your estrogen while on cycle then pct reboots your natural control mechanisms for hormone levels know as the hypothalamic pituitary axis. Labs are essential to monitoring your levels and can be done at private labs without a doctors monitoring....
